So I ended up needing a crankshaft for my model 20 and have decided to have some cast from ductile iron this has been done before and the ones in use have held up well at least, the ones I could find information on. Also the foundry has made other crankshafts in class 80 iron with no reported problems so this seems to be a good option. I also spent some time figuring out that the factory crankshaft was close to a 1030 steel forging what that means is the ductile iron will be as strong if not stronger than our factory crankshafts these are also beefed up a little. I have spent countless hours researching iron grades and all options to reproduce a crankshaft for our cars and many phone calls to find a foundry that pours ductile iron and would do the job and had experience with crankshafts this was the best overall option I could find that was affordable.
